In a lot of populaces, lung cancer prices are a lot greater in current cigarette smokers than in long-lasting non-smokers. The proportionate increase in the threat of lung cancer each boost in interior radon concentration is comparable in long-lasting non-smokers and also cigarette smokers in research studies of residential radon (Table 3).
With regard to the threat from exposure throughout childhood years, the BEIR VI Record mentions that there is "no clear sign of the result old at exposure" (NAS/NRC 1999). Consequently, in computing threats from lifetime direct exposure, the risk models did not change particularly for exposure at earlier ages. The record does consist of a little change for exposure to infants. Because the majority of the researches of the risk from radon included below ground miners, nearly all of whom were grownups revealed at high levels about household exposures, it would have been hard to determine a certain danger for exposure in childhood. For those having actually quit cigarette smoking, the radon-related dangers are substantially lower than for those who continue to smoke, yet they continue to be substantially higher than the dangers for lifelong non-smokers. The 3 pooling studies present an extremely similar picture of the danger of lung cancer cells from residential exposure to radon (cf. Table 2). There is overwhelming evidence that radon is working as a source of lung cancer in the general populace at focus discovered in average residences. Particularly, in all 3 pooling researches there was no proof that the proportional boost in threat each increase in radon focus differed with the sex, cigarette smoking or age habits of the research study subjects more than would certainly be anticipated by coincidence. Furthermore, the dose-response partnership appeared to be straight, with no proof of a threshold, and there was significant proof of a threat boost also below 200 Bq/m3, the focus at which activity is presently advocated in lots of countries.
The National Academy of Sciences/National Research Study Council (NAS/NRC) was entrusted with evaluating the epidemiologic studies. The danger models in their record, Wellness Effects of Exposure to Radon (the BEIR VI Report) (NAS/NRC 1999), consisted of variables to account for a reduction in danger with time considering that direct exposure. Nonetheless, domestic radon epidemiological studies, with reduced collective exposures, have not reported a decline in danger with time because direct exposure.

The first significant research studies with radon and wellness took place in the context of uranium mining, initially in the Joachimsthal region of Bohemia and then in the Southwestern USA during the early Cold Battle. Since radon is a product of the contaminated degeneration of uranium, below ground uranium mines might have high concentrations of radon. Numerous uranium miners in the 4 Corners region contracted lung cancer cells as well as various other pathologies as a result of high levels of direct exposure to radon in the mid-1950s. The size of lung cancer danger seen in below ground miners subjected to radon highly suggests that radon might be a source of lung cancer cells in the general population due to the direct exposure that occurs inside residences and various other structures. The problems of direct exposure in mines and also inside vary appreciably (NRC 1991), and also the smoking-related dangers in the miners that have actually been studied vary from the smoking-related risks in the basic populaces of today. Other components of lung cancer cells threat vary between exposure in mines and indoors. As an example, much of the miners were revealed to various other lung health hazards, such as arsenic, in addition to radon. All these differences mean that there is substantial unpredictability in extrapolating from the miner research studies to obtain a quantitative assessment of the danger of lung cancer cells from radon in the house.
